Thomas Paine 1539 – 1631 – Genealogical Records

Birth Date: 11 Dec 1539

Birth Location: Halesworth, Suffolk, England

Death Date: 14 April 1631

Death Location: Cookley, Suffolk Coastal District, Suffolk, England

Father: Sir Payne)

Mother: Lady Ash

Spouse(s): Katherine Cransford

Children(s): Robert Paine

The story of Thomas Paine began in 1539 in Halesworth, Suffolk, England. Thomas Paine married Katherine Harasant de Cransford, and had children including Robert Thomas Harssant Paine. Thomas Paine passed away in 1631 in Cookley, Suffolk Coastal District, Suffolk, England.
